Python读取合并单元格操作流程

状态图

stateDiagram
    [*] --> 读取文件
    读取文件 --> 解析数据
    解析数据 --> 合并单元格
    合并单元格 --> 输出结果
    输出结果 --> [*]

读取文件

  1. 打开Excel文件
import pandas as pd

data = pd.read_excel('file.xlsx')

解析数据

  1. 查看数据结构
data.head()
  1. 确定需要合并的单元格
start_row = 1
end_row = 3
start_col = 'A'
end_col = 'B'

合并单元格

  1. 使用pandas库的merge_cells方法合并单元格
from openpyxl import load_workbook

wb = load_workbook('file.xlsx')
ws = wb.active
ws.merge_cells(start_row=start_row, end_row=end_row, start_column=ord(start_col)-64, end_column=ord(end_col)-64)
wb.save('file.xlsx')

输出结果

  1. 保存文件
data.to_excel('file.xlsx', index=False)

以上是Python读取合并单元格的操作流程,希望对你有所帮助。如果有任何问题,欢迎随时向我咨询。加油!